Job Summary
We are seeking a proactive and highly organized Executive Assistant to support the Oceania Leadership Team within our Taste business unit. This role is pivotal in ensuring the smooth execution of strategic and operational initiatives across the region. Reporting directly to the Oceania Sub-Regional Leader, you will provide high-level administrative support, coordinate special projects, assist with accounts payable, manage events, and oversee day-to-day office operations.
This is a dynamic position that requires strong collaboration with cross-functional teams, excellent communication skills, and the ability to manage multiple priorities. If you're passionate about enabling leadership success and contributing to a fast-paced, innovative environment, we'd love to hear from you.
Open to candidates from Sydney or Melbourne
Key responsibilities will include:
Administration and Office Management
- Respond to incoming reception calls as required
- Purchase products and services across Oceania sites, in accordance with company purchasing requirements
- Reconcile credit cards and liaise with accounts payable for cost center reallocations.
- Draft and circulate internal communication
- Receive and distribute deliveries
- Liaise with the Sample Room regarding shipping
Meetings, workshops, conferences, and event management
- Schedule and diarise regional meetings
- Arrange all travel, team building activities, meeting room set-up (including tech), and catering needs
- Draft and circulate event communication internally and post-event social media (Viva Engage) company-wide posts.
- Prepare PowerPoint presentations and reports as requested
- Order IFF-branded merchandise for the site and Commercial team as requested
- Manage end-to-end annual staff and customer Christmas gifts
- Liaise with the Regional Graphic Designer for design needs in line with branding.
Capital Expenditure (CAPEX) Support
- Initiate vendor onboarding in collaboration with the offshore procurement team.
- Create and manage PRs, PO conversion requests, GRs, and submission to offshore accounts payable for IR.
- Liaise with the offshore accounts payable, finance, and fixed asset teams to track invoices and request reclassification of costs.
- Manage accurate and comprehensive document control following the established filing protocols.
- Attend monthly budget and forecasting update meetings.
- Assist with the preparation of the monthly dashboard update and circulate to the site on behalf of the Project Director
- Assist with meeting organisation as requested
Project Management
- Manage end-to-end site-based projects
- Create and manage PRs, PO conversion requests, GRs, and submission to offshore accounts payable for IR.
- Attend monthly budget and forecasting update meetings and report on project spending against forecasting (EcoSys)
- Manage contractors, site induction, materials, and monitor activities, safety, and compliance.
- Communicate updates and issues to all staff on site.
- Maintain accurate project documentation, including contracts and emails.
- Conduct inspections and quality checks and sign off.
Background
- Proven experience in executive support, office management, accounts payable, and event coordination
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- Skilled in cross-functional collaboration and stakeholder engagement
- Demonstrated ability to handle sensitive information with discretion
- Proficient in Microsoft 360, Teams, SharePoint, SAP, and SAP Concur; quick to learn new systems
- Responsive and proactive with excellent time management and organisational skills
- Collaborative team player with attention to detail and accuracy
